Ending Landscape Conservation Rules: Impact on Western Economy

This act aims to repeal rules concerning landscape conservation and health managed by the Bureau of Land Management. This means that previous regulations on the conservation of public lands in the Western United States will no longer be in effect. This could influence how these lands are used, potentially opening them up for other economic activities.
Key points
Repeal of Bureau of Land Management rules on conservation and landscape health.
Potential changes in the management of public lands in the Western US, affecting their use.
